The global automotive keyless entry system market is expected to surge from approximately USD 2.04 billion in 2023 to around USD 4.62 billion by 2032, growing at a compound annual growth rate (CAGR) of roughly 9.5% over the forecast period. According to research from Introspective Market Research (IMR), this growth trajectory is underpinned by accelerating electric vehicle (EV) penetration, rising consumer demand for convenience, enhanced vehicle security features, and the rising integration of connected-car and smart-access technologies.

The shift from traditional mechanical keys to smart, wireless, and smartphone-based access systems is becoming standard across passenger cars and commercial fleets worldwide. As automakers embed keyless-entry systems deeper into vehicle architecture and regulators, insurers, and consumers demand higher security demand for advanced keyless entry systems is seeing robust growth across OEM and aftermarket channels.

What’s Driving the Surge? What Trends Are Emerging?

  • EV and Smart Vehicle Boom: Electric and connected vehicles often come with advanced access and security features as standard boosting demand for integrated keyless systems. 
  • Convenience & Connected-Car Expectations: Consumers increasingly expect features like remote locking/unlocking, smartphone-based access, remote start, and app-based control turning keyless entry into a baseline feature. 
  • Enhanced Security Features: With rising vehicle theft and unauthorized access concerns, manufacturers are adding encrypted communication, RFID/BLE, NFC or UWB-based proximity keys, and even multi-factor authentication. 
  • Aftermarket & Retrofit Demand: Owners of older vehicles increasingly seek aftermarket keyless systems for upgrade, driven by cost-effectiveness and convenience. 
  • Fleet & Commercial Vehicle Adoption: Logistics, delivery and ride-hailing fleets increasingly demand keyless and smartphone-based access for security and operational flexibility.

Latest Innovations & Industry Developments

  • Automakers are increasingly pairing keyless entry with smartphone-as-key and digital-key solutions, enabling owners to unlock, start, and configure vehicles via mobile apps. This reduces reliance on physical key-fobs and improves convenience.
  • Integration of RFID, Bluetooth Low Energy (BLE), UWB and NFC technologies is improving security and reducing vulnerability to relay or spoofing attacks compared with older remote-fob systems.
  • Growing aftermarket offerings for retrofitting older vehicles with modern keyless entry systems, catering to cost-conscious consumers and fleet operators who want to upgrade existing vehicles without full replacement.

Challenges & Cost Pressures

  • Security Risks: Despite improvements, keyless systems remain targets for relay attacks, signal spoofing, and cyber intrusions raising consumer and regulatory concerns. 
  • Component & Raw-Material Costs: Rising costs for electronic components, semiconductors, sensors, and secure chips can increase manufacturing costs and pressure margins.
  • Integration Complexity: As vehicles become more connected (EVs, telematics, smart-car features), integrating keyless systems securely and reliably with other systems (ignition, locking, vehicle controls) requires robust design and validation.
  • Regulatory & Safety Compliance: Varying standards across regions cryptography standards, anti-theft regulations, data privacy can raise compliance costs and complicate global product deployment.
  • Aftermarket Reliability: Retrofitting and aftermarket installations may face reliability, warranty and interoperability challenges compared with OEM-fitted systems.

Case Study: Retrofitting Fleet in Asia-Pacific Delivery Fleet Upgrades Keyless Entry for Efficiency & Security

A major delivery-fleet operator in Southeast Asia retrofitted 1,200 light commercial vehicles (LCVs) with smartphone-enabled passive keyless entry (PKE) systems using Bluetooth Low Energy and encrypted RFID modules. Within 9 months:

  • Incidents of vehicle theft or unauthorized access dropped by 67%
  • Fleet maintenance downtime reduced by 22%, thanks to fewer lost keys and streamlined vehicle access
  • Driver convenience and user satisfaction improved positive feedback from 89% of drivers on ease of use and reduced locking hassles

This deployment underscores how keyless entry systems especially smartphone-enabled and encrypted solutions deliver both operational efficiency and enhanced security for commercial fleets.
